The Trial Appointment Is Not Optional

I say this to every single bride who books with us: come for a trial.

Not because I need to practice on your face. Because you need to see how the makeup sits on your specific skin after a few hours. You need to see if the lip colour works with your outfit in real light, not just inside a makeup room. You need to see if anything needs adjusting before the actual wedding day.

Brides who skip trials are the ones most likely to feel uncertain on the day itself. The trial is where we work out every detail so that on the wedding day, both of us already know exactly what the plan is.

For wedding season we recommend booking your trial at least 4 to 6 weeks before the wedding. Not the week before.

The Skin Prep That Most Brides Ignore

Your skin on wedding day is directly related to how your skin has been treated in the months before.

Makeup can do a lot. But it cannot cover dehydrated skin convincingly. It cannot cover active acne without looking heavy. It cannot make skin that is uneven and pigmented look flawless without a base so thick it looks like a mask.

At CV Salon, we have a pre-bridal skincare programme that starts 3 months before the wedding. Month 1 focuses on addressing whatever the main concern is, whether acne, pigmentation, or dehydration. Month 2 builds on that with brightening. Month 3, closest to the wedding, is about glow and hydration.

Brides who follow this programme look noticeably different on their wedding day compared to brides who come in for their first facial the week before. The difference is not subtle.

You do not have to do the programme at CV Salon. But do something. Start 3 months before. That is the single most important skincare advice for a bride.

Questions to Ask Before Booking Any Bridal Makeup Artist

Whether you book with CV Salon or anywhere else in Jabalpur, ask these before confirming:

Will the same artist who does my trial also do my wedding day makeup? At CV Salon, yes. But many salons assign a different person on the day.

What products do you use? Ask by brand. If the answer is vague, that is information.

How many brides do you take per day? This directly affects how much time and attention you get.

Do you have before and after photos from real brides with skin tones similar to mine? Not just the prettiest brides in the portfolio.

What happens if the artist is sick on my wedding day? What is the backup plan?

These are not rude questions. They are sensible ones. Any professional will answer them directly.

What Nobody Tells You About Wedding Morning Timelines

Wedding morning is chaotic. The room is full of family. The photographer arrives early. There are a hundred small emergencies. The mehendi artist ran late the night before.

Bridal makeup for a full look takes 2.5 to 3.5 hours depending on the look and the bride. This is not negotiable. Rushing it produces results that are visible in photos for the rest of your life.

Plan your makeup start time by working backwards from when you need to be ready. Add 30 minutes buffer. Then stick to that schedule.
